Question: Why does the Torah conceal secrets that are so essential to manage in this complicated world?
Answer: The Torah doesn’t conceal anything. A person doesn’t need to know more than he does; otherwise, he may become confused and do something silly. If he wants to understand more, he must study the wisdom of Kabbalah regularly.
There are no prohibitions regarding the study, only internal, natural, psychological prohibitions. In a person’s head and heart, there are safety valves that do not allow him to see or know what actually is happening in this world.
A person only sees the external wrapping of it. And the deeper internality he cannot know so he will not touch it with his “dirty hands.” Therefore, he must first engage in the study and show himself and the world that he is ready for a right, good, and sensible action. And to that extent, he can advance.

Question: The Torah talks about a prohibition against fortune telling…does the wisdom of Kabbalah predict the future?
Answer: Fortunetellers only ruin life for us. A person doesn’t need to think about the future and ask questions about maintaining his perishable body. We need to attain a soul. Where is our soul? It is necessary to discover and develop it, connect with it, and live within it, not within the body.
Question: In the Torah it is said that it is necessary to kill, burn, execute, or hang fortunetellers. What is your explanation of this? What are these four types of death according to the Torah?
Answer: What the Torah is talking about is completely irrelevant to our world. When it talks about four types of death, it is not referring to the physical body but to the soul and how it is destroyed by a person. He is the only one who can harm it.
Nobody else has the ability to reach and influence the human soul. A positive influence on it is expressed in elevation to the level of the Creator. A negative influence is a descent through four phases that are symbolized by strangulation, stoning, decapitation, and immolation. But these four types of punishment of the soul are in a case where a person neglects its development.
Question: What does the use of these deaths mean in regard to predictions of my future?
Answer: A prediction of my death symbolizes that I must fix a characteristic within me, which I get rid of from within me. It is an internal correction and no more than that.
Question: A person must correct his own soul. Is he “burning” his uncorrected desires this way?
Answer: Nobody is capable of touching a person’s soul other than himself. If he goes deeply into his spiritual development, he can influence his soul in any direction, either in a bad direction or a good direction.

We are inside the special system that is called “nature” or “Creator,” which is one and the same. This system is closed, perfect, and constant, and humanity receives reactions and influences from it and develops more and more.
The system works on us, trying to bring us into conformity with it, so that we would feel, attain, and become similar to nature by becoming its active integral parts consciously, according to our decision and through our work.
A person should become a master of this system—all people as one creature. In order to become as perfect as the system of nature, we must connect as one man.
Bestowal to each other, mutual connection and support, up to loving your neighbor as yourself, is the law of the single system in which we exist. This system works on us in order to bring us to its state.
Therefore, the law about loving the neighbor is a mandatory law of development that acts upon us regardless of our desire or reluctance. The wisdom of Kabbalah teaches us how to fulfill this law so that the advancement will go by a good way, according to the mutual consent of the Creator and creature. Then our development will be fast and enjoyable.
Through a good or a bad way, sooner or later we still advance getting closer to the qualities of the system of nature. We see that the world is changing all the time, each time revealing more advanced states in order to finally fulfill the compulsory requirement. Altruism, a general connection above all the differences, is the basic law of nature, so it should be carried out among the people as well.
Inanimate matter, plants, and animals exist without freedom of choice, but a person must understand this law and agree with it, so much so that even if he has an opportunity to choose something else, he nevertheless prefers this altruistic law of complete connection with others.
Altruism is the final state of the evolution of nature to which we shall come. Along the way, we always pass through two states, two lines. We enter the left line, sufferings and troubles, and then we understand that it is necessary to connect and rush to the right line.
Humanity moves this way: sometimes brutal regimes arise, and other times more kind and merciful ones. Again and again evil and good replace each other, until finally, after all these sufferings, we would say, “enough!” and will be able to unite completely.
Question: Why is the reaction of the system on human behavior so nonlinear and complicated? One nation doesn’t act in an integral form, and the system hits another nation. Everything is so confusing it is difficult to advance.
Answer: Indeed, advancement is not carried out according to our understanding and feeling, but in accordance with the reason and the sense of the higher degree called “faith above reason.” After all, we advance due to the higher forces of nature. Why did it organize so we can’t see anything on this path?
The Kabbalists explain that if we had an opportunity to see everything, we would never ascend to the higher degree. We would only extend the material horizons on our degree.
However, in order to ascend to the next level, it is necessary to change our internal work program, our desires, intentions, and thoughts. This is impossible to do while staying in the same sense and reason. We need to receive strength from above and constantly improve ourselves with its help.
We can’t receive additional spiritual development with the tools we currently have. It is possible to receive material development though because it happens at the same level. There are smart and stupid people, strong and weak, successful and losers, but all of this doesn’t relate to qualitative development.
Qualitative development is the transition to the next level, like the difference between inanimate, vegetative, and animate levels, or between a fish, a beetle, a dog, and a man. It means this is a qualitative development in the perception of reality, or to be more precise, in the approximation to the upper force that controls everything.
Such a development assumes the renunciation of one’s current degree in order to be included each time more and more in the upper degree. Therefore, we can’t perform the qualitative ascent by ourselves. We can’t understand the upper degree before we rise to it because it is above us. We don’t feel it.
A stone can’t feel how a plant lives. There is a connection between the degrees, but not in the sense and reason. Precisely by annulling my sense and reason, I can receive some kind of foretaste of the next degree.
The way a stone can’t feel a plant and a plant can’t feel an animal, so too a person can’t feel the upper force. Only if we work in order to get closer to it do we cause its reaction and eventually will be in contact with it.
For the first time in history human begins to climb the ladder of nature, from our world to the upper world. The difference here is not the same as between a stone and a plant, but much more qualitative.

Dr. Michael Laitman in conversation with Oren Levi and Nitzah Mazoz
Summary
How does a person develop through the game, what is the goal of the game in our lives, and how is it possible to be clothed in the character of the divine and understand the game of life?
All our lives we play characters.
Children play games, do sports exercises and the like. Teenagers already begin to play characters. Basically all of us play different characters all of our lives, at home, at work, everywhere. We don’t know who we truly are. No person is familiar with himself. The ego obligates us to play characters.
It is possible to discover who I am only if I will begin to clothe in new forms that are of benefit to others, like the Creator. Playing the character of the divine means being good and beneficent to everyone. This is the most enjoyable game.
When a person wants to play the character of the divine, he begins to get the feeling and the understanding of what that is. This is not talking about just doing good. I must learn well what it means to be good like the divine. We learn this together, in a group of players. This is the most enjoyable, most complicated and most excellent game.
This is not about thinking that you are divine like a crazy person thinks, but is about the effort to be like Him in your attitude toward others.
